#5d3ea6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5d3ea6 is composed of 36.5% red, 24.3% green and 65.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44% cyan, 62.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 34.9% black. It has a hue angle of 257.9 degrees, a saturation of 45.6% and a lightness of 44.7%. #5d3ea6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ba7cff with #00004d.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

Shades and Tints of #5d3ea6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050309 is the darkest color, while #fbfaf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#5d3ea6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6f6a7a is the less saturated color, while #4401e3 is the most saturated one.
